Kinds Of Built-In Ovens
Single Built-In Ovens: These are basic ovens that provide one cavity for baking and roasting. Ideal for house owners with modest cooking requirements.

Double Built-In Ovens: With 2 different cavities, these ovens enable for simultaneous cooking at different temperatures, making them best for [large built in ovens](https://hack.allmende.io/jVui-s16RhmLDJvf9VPm4w/) families or passionate bakers.

Mix Ovens: These multifunctional appliances combine standard oven abilities with microwave functions, offering versatility for quicker meal preparations.

Steam Ovens: These ovens utilize steam to prepare food, maintaining nutrients and flavors while guaranteeing moisture retention.
Secret Features to Consider
When searching for built-in ovens, a number of features can enhance cooking experiences and outcomes. Below are essential features to think about:

Size and Fit: Ensure that the oven fits your kitchen's requirements and kitchen cabinetry. Requirement sizes consist of 24", 27", and 30" widths.

Oven Capacity: Larger ovens provide more space for cooking several meals at the same time, which is useful for meal prep and amusing.

Cooking Modes: Look for ovens that offer a variety of cooking modes, including convection, baking, broiling, and self-cleaning functions.

Controls and Display: User-friendly controls, whether digital or manual, add to much better cooking experiences. Touch screens and self-diagnostics can boost ease of use.

Energy Efficiency: Energy-efficient designs conserve electrical energy and minimize energy costs. Try to find the ENERGY STAR certification.

Convection Technology: Convection ovens distribute hot air for even cooking, minimizing cooking time and energy usage.

Guarantee and Support: Robust service warranties and client assistance can offer comfort with your financial investment.

Maintenance and Care Tips
To maintain the durability and efficiency of built-in ovens, follow these fundamental care pointers:

Regular Cleaning: Wipe the interior and outside of the oven frequently to prevent buildup and ensure it operates efficiently.

Examine Seals: Inspect the door seals regularly for damage. Damaged seals can result in heat loss and ineffective cooking.

Self-Cleaning Features: Utilize self-cleaning options according to maker guidelines to keep your oven in pristine condition.

Routine Checks: Regularly look for any error codes, which can indicate when professional maintenance may be required.
